AP Computer Science Principles is designed to introduce students to the foundational concepts of computer science, including algorithms, data representation, and programming. While the AP exam is typically taken in high school, advanced 7th graders can absolutely begin learning these concepts through accelerated or honors-level instruction. Starting early gives students a significant advantage, allowing them to build problem-solving skills and coding proficiency before formal AP coursework.

The curriculum typically includes programming fundamentals (variables, loops, conditionals), algorithm design, data representation, and basic computational thinking. For 7th graders in Indianapolis, instruction often focuses on block-based or beginner-friendly languages like Scratch or Python before moving to more complex languages. The goal is to build logical reasoning and problem-solving skills that form the foundation for advanced computer science study.

Common struggles include understanding abstract concepts like variables and loops, debugging code when errors occur, and translating real-world problems into algorithmic solutions. Many students also find it challenging to think logically through multi-step problems without getting frustrated.
